Jennifer Garner showed off her incredibly toned arms in a white tank top during a morning run with her son, Samuel, in Los Angeles on Sunday.

As she ran down the street, the 51-year-old actress’s preteen rode alongside her on his blue bicycle.

After working up a sweat together, the Alias ​​actress, wearing a pair of black camo leggings and white sneakers, stopped for a refresher at Starbucks.

The Golden Globe completed her sporty ensemble with her Apple Watch, over-the-calf compression stockings, minimal makeup, and her light brown hair pulled up in a low bun.

During their outing, her 11-year-old wore an oversized purple hoodie, black helmet, gray pants and sneakers.

The Houston-born beauty, who lives in Brentwood, shares her baby son and daughters Violet, 17, and Seraphina, 14, with her ex-husband, Ben Affleck.

The A-list exes tied the knot in 2005 after working together on Pearl Harbor and Daredevil.

However, things ultimately didn’t work out between the Elektra co-stars (Ben returned as Daredevil in deleted scenes), with the pair splitting for good in 2016.

They finalized their divorce two years later and now have an amicable co-parenting relationship.

While appearing on The Drew Barrymore Show last April, Garner shared how she incorporates jogging into her daily sweat-breaking effort.

“What I do in the morning is exercise,” she told Barrymore, who looked puzzled, and replied, “Every day?! Oh God.’

Seeing how defeated the host looked as Garner learned to train almost every day, she clarified her revelation by adding, “No, Drew, really. You have to do heavy cardio to get that – to get yourself – I’m sorry, you do.”

Garner went on to share how she believes that moving our bodies not only improves the body, but also the mind and brain.

The artist actually has the science to back up her claims about how exercise can enhance mental health benefits.

A study published in the March issue of the British Journal Of Sports Medicine found it to be more effective than medication in treating anxiety and depression.

For people who have had trouble sticking to a consistent exercise regimen, like Barrymore, Garner suggested finding exercise activities they enjoy.

“You find something that really makes you happy while you’re doing it, otherwise it won’t work, because this isn’t going to work,” the Once Upon A Farm co-founder told the talk show host.
